Watch Genjitsu Shugi Yuusha no Oukoku Saikenki Part 2 (Dub) Episode 13 online at AnimeSuge


Genjitsu Shugi Yuusha no Oukoku Saikenki Part 2 (Dub) Episode 13

Genjitsu Shugi Yuusha no Oukoku Saikenki Part 2 (Dub)

List episode

Latest Episodes